Summary: The Azure Integration Specialist role focuses on enhancing the integration landscape for a growing international business, particularly with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central. The position involves designing, building, and optimizing integrations across a multi-entity European environment. The specialist will collaborate with various stakeholders to ensure reliable system connectivity and support ongoing transformation initiatives. This role is primarily remote with occasional travel required.
Key Responsibilities:
- Design, build and maintain integrations between Dynamics 365 Business Central and other internal/third-party systems
- Work across Azure Integration Services (Logic Apps, Service Bus, API Management, Functions)
- Support data flows, APIs and Middleware to ensure reliable system connectivity
- Collaborate with finance, IT and third-party vendors to gather requirements and translate into technical solutions
- Troubleshoot integration issues and optimise performance
- Support ongoing transformation and system improvement initiatives
- Ensure integrations are secure, scalable and well-documented
Key Skills:
- Strong experience with Azure Integration Services (Logic Apps, Service Bus, Functions, APIs)
- Proven experience integrating with Dynamics 365 Business Central
- Experience working in complex, multi-system environments
- Strong understanding of API-led architecture and data integration patterns
- Ability to work across both technical teams and business stakeholders
- Experience with data mapping, transformation and error handling
